describe_deployment

Retrieve detailed information about a Kubernetes deployment, including status and configuration, by specifying namespace and deployment name.

Instructions

Shows details of a deployment.

Input Schema

TableJSON Schema
N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
clusterNoTarget cluster name (default: 'default')
namespaceYesThe Kubernetes namespace
deploymentNameYesThe name of the deployment
